The producers of the UK and Ireland tour and WhatsOnStage Award-nominated musical HERE & NOW, presented by UK pop sensation, Steps, are delighted to announce that Coronation Street star Sally Ann Matthews will take over the role of Patricia from 23 January 2026. Sally takes over the role from originator Finty Williams who finished her run in December 2025.

Sally Ann Matthews is best known for playing the role of Jenny Bradley in ITV’s Coronation Street. She joined the show in 1986 through to 1991, she returned for a brief return in 1993 before coming back as a regular in 2015 staying with the show until October 2025. Outside of the role that spanned 39 years Sally has starred in various theatre productions including: Mum’s The Word (UK Tour), The Business of Murder (UK Tour), Present Laughter (UK Tour), Killing Time (UK Tour) and The Accrington Pals (Bolton Octagon).

Her other TV and film credits include: Murdered by My Boyfriend (BBC), The 4 O’Clock Club (BBC), My Mad Fat Diary (Channel 4), EastEnders (BBC), Being Human (BBC), Song for Marion (Steel Mill Pictures) and Brassed Off (Miramax Films).

Featuring Steps’ most beloved hit songs, HERE & NOW has an original book by Shaun Kitchener and is produced by the band and ROYO with Pete Waterman. It is directed by Rachel Kavanaugh, with choreography by Olivier Award-winning Matt Cole and Matt Spencer-Smith as musical supervisor, orchestrator and arranger.

Steps (Claire Richards, Faye Tozer, Ian ‘H’ Watkins, Lee Latchford-Evans and Lisa Scott-Lee) are the UK’s most successful mixed sex pop group of all time, with 14 top five singles, 4 number one albums, 22 million record sales, 500 million streams & 11 sold-out national arena tours under their belts. The band’s hits include #1 singles Tragedy/Heartbeat and Stomp, the gold certified One For Sorrow & Better Best Forgotten, the silver certified 5,6,7,8Last Thing On My MindLove’s Got A Hold On My HeartChain Reaction, all of which will feature in the musical alongside many more.

Steps’ 2017 comeback tour sold out all 300,000 tickets, making it one of the biggest pop tours of the year. The band have since continued to release new music including two further iTunes #1 singles, the Sia-penned What The Future Holds in 2020 and the Michelle Visage duet Heartbreak In This City in 2022. In 2022 Steps celebrated their 25th anniversary with a headline summer tour and released the #1 album Platinum Collection which means they join ABBA, Rolling Stones and Stereophonics as the only groups in UK history to score #1 albums in four consecutive decades.
